Output c52abbae024c698b1949e673ea4a6005ea7ca3cd36d7d5d871fa839b5fa7e24e:0

value
390000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d03c1a7abf702e37990b73feb55570687e64f0d1 OP_EQUAL
address
3Lg4UWD292DGqu5pvqetpbuczqcQTcQdR2
transaction
c52abbae024c698b1949e673ea4a6005ea7ca3cd36d7d5d871fa839b5fa7e24e
confirmations
309105
spent
true